TAKE THE FREE 'ARE YOU ACTUALLY READY TO RETIRE' QUIZ https://retirementquiz.netlify.app/ WORK WITH ME AND THE TEAM 1-1 retirement planning conversation with me https://tfp-fp.com/retirement-assessment/ WHAT'S THIS VIDEO ABOUT A 60-year-old in decent health has roughly 12 to 15 good years ahead. The State Pension doesn’t arrive until 67. Do you really want to spend over half your best years still working? In this video, I walk through exactly how to retire at 60 in the UK: the seven-year bridge you need to cross, the tax goldmine hiding in your bridge years (worth £15,000–30,000+), how to adapt the bucket strategy for early retirement, two worked examples with real numbers, and the question nobody asks — what are you actually retiring to? Whether you’re planning or you’ve been pushed, this is the complete framework. TAKE THE FREE 'ARE YOU ACTUALLY READY TO RETIRE' QUIZ https://retirementquiz.netlify.app/ WORK WITH ME AND THE TEAM 1-1 retirement planning conversation with me: https://www.tfp-fp.com/retirement-assessment/ WHAT'S THIS VIDEO ABOUT New ONS data (released February 2026) confirms that while UK life expectancy is rising, healthy life expectancy has fallen to its lowest level since records began. The gap between being alive and being well is widening — and this changes everything about how retirees should think about spending, planning, and living. In this video, I break down the numbers, explain the behavioural trap they reveal, and give you five practical steps to make the most of your healthiest years.
